What is a poem?

Back

A poem is a piece of writing that expresses feelings, ideas, or tells a story in a creative way, often using rhythm and rhyme.

What is a stanza?

Back

A stanza is a group of lines in a poem, similar to a paragraph in a story.

What is rhyme?

Back

Rhyme is when two or more words have the same ending sound, like 'cat' and 'hat'.

What is a rhyme scheme?

Back

A rhyme scheme is the pattern of rhymes at the end of each line of a poem, often labeled with letters.

What is imagery in poetry?

Back

Imagery is the use of descriptive language that creates pictures in the reader's mind.
